Uncomment and update vs-eav-api configuration in Istio for brusnika-stage cluster: add multiple route mappings with updated rewrite rules.

This commit is contained in:
emelinda 2026-06-05 17:22:05 +03:00
parent cf71de4e8c
commit fbd0cc989a

View File

@ -677,17 +677,54 @@ spec:
rewrite: /api/ rewrite: /api/
service: pdm-api.documentations.svc.cluster.local service: pdm-api.documentations.svc.cluster.local
port: 8080 port: 8080
#
# vs-eav-api: vs-eav-api:
# namespace: ingress-nginx namespace: ingress-nginx
# hosts: hosts:
# - test.sarex.brusnika.tech - test.sarex.brusnika.tech
# gateways: gateways:
# - ingress-nginx/main-gateway - ingress-nginx/main-gateway
# routes: routes:
# - match: - match:
# - uri: - uri:
# prefix: /eav/api/ prefix: /eav/api/v0
# rewrite: /api/ rewrite:
# service: eav-service.eav.svc.cluster.local uri: /api/v4
# port: 8000 service: eav-service.eav.svc.cluster.local
port: 8000
- match:
- uri:
prefix: /eav/api/v2
rewrite:
uri: /api/v5
service: eav-service.eav.svc.cluster.local
port: 8000
- match:
- uri:
prefix: /eav/api/v3
rewrite:
uri: /api/v3
service: eav-service.eav.svc.cluster.local
port: 8000
- match:
- uri:
prefix: /eav/api/v4
rewrite:
uri: /api/v4
service: eav-service.eav.svc.cluster.local
port: 8000
- match:
- uri:
prefix: /eav/api/v1
rewrite:
uri: /api/v6
service: eav-service.eav.svc.cluster.local
port: 8000
- match:
- uri:
prefix: /eav/admin
rewrite:
uri: /admin-api
service: eav-service.eav.svc.cluster.local
port: 8000